Overview

Altera Recruitment Group is seeking a highly organised and proactive Project Coordinator on behalf of our partner, a fast-growing renewable energy company. This hands-on role is ideal for a candidate with experience supporting technical or commercial projects who thrives in a dynamic, high-impact environment. The successful Project Coordinator will help coordinate project delivery, strengthen processes, and ensure accurate tracking and documentation across multiple workstreams.

Responsibilities
  • Coordinate and support cross-functional projects, ensuring timelines, milestones, and deliverables are achieved.
  • Develop and maintain project plans, schedules, and dashboards to monitor progress and highlight risks.
  • Manage project documentation, including meeting notes, action logs, risk registers, and status reports, ensuring accuracy and version control.
  • Work closely with technical and operational teams to allocate resources and maintain clear communication of project objectives.
  • Contribute to process improvements and assist with reporting to grant or funding bodies where applicable.
Candidate Requirements
  • Demonstrable experience supporting project delivery or PMO functions, ideally within engineering, technology, or renewable energy sectors.
  • Strong organisational ability with proven experience managing competing tasks and deadlines.
  • Skilled in using project management platforms or comparable tools to track and report progress.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with the confidence to engage stakeholders across different teams and levels.
  • Self-motivated, resourceful, and able to adapt quickly in a dynamic, fast-paced work environment.
